AFTERBURNER

INTRODUCTION

• To move an airplane through the air, thrust is generated by some kind of propulsion
system. Most modern fighter aircraft employ an afterburner on either a low bypass
turbofan or a turbojet.
• A simple way to get the necessary thrust is to add an afterburner to a core turbojet.
CONTENT

FUNCTION
• Its purpose is to provide an increase in thrust.
• To turn the turbine. (TURBOJET).
• To gain back some energy.

HOW?
• By overcoming a sharp rise in drag near the speed of sound.
• By injecting fuel directly into the hot exhaust.
